
拓海先生、部下から『この論文が良い』って言われたのですが、正直タイトルを見てもピンと来ません。うちの現場で役に立つ話でしょうか。

素晴らしい着眼点ですね!大丈夫、要点を整理しますよ。簡単に言うと、この研究は『データの持つ特別な掛け合わせ構造(Kronecker構造)を利用して、まばら(スパース)な信号をより正確かつ効率的に復元する方法』を示したものです。現場で使えるかは、扱う信号やデータの構造に依るのですが、通信やセンサー系で効果を発揮しますよ。

これ、難しそうですね。Kroneckerって聞くだけで頭が痛い。投資対効果が見えなければ現場は動かせません。

素晴らしい着眼点ですね!まず結論を三点でまとめます。1) 精度改善: 特殊な掛け合わせ構造を使うことで、少ない観測からでも正確に復元できる。2) 計算効率: その構造を利用すると計算を分解でき、速くなる。3) 応用性: 無線通信(IRS支援MIMOなど)やセンサーネットワークに直接役立つ可能性が高いのです。

これって要するに〇〇ということ?

良い確認ですね!そのまま当てはめるなら、『構造を知っていると、少ないリソースで正しい答えを出せる』ということです。身近な例で言うと、散らばった書類が机の上にあるときに、種類ごとに箱が用意されている方が片付けやすいのと同じです。ここでは『箱の形』がKronecker構造に当たりますよ。

なるほど。では現実問題として、導入に当たってどんなアルゴリズムが使われているのか、運用コストや安定性はどうかが気になります。

素晴らしい着眼点ですね!論文では主に二つの手法を示しています。一つは交互最小化(Alternating Minimization、AM)を使う方法で、理論的な収束保証があるため安定性が高いのです。もう一つは特異値分解(Singular Value Decomposition、SVD)を利用した高速法で、実験では精度と速度の両方で優れていました。

収束保証があるのは安心ですが、実装の難しさや現場の計算資源はどうでしょう。うちの工場のPLCやエッジ機器で回るものではないのではと心配です。

素晴らしい着眼点ですね!実務的にはこう考えるとよいです。第一に、AM法は安定でチューニングしやすいため、まずはサーバ側で試し、その後SVD法へ段階的に移す。第二に、計算は分解できるので部分をクラウドやエッジに分配できる。第三に、ブロック化(block sparsity)という拡張も論文で扱っており、現場データのまとまりを活かせばさらに効率化できるのです。

よく分かってきました。これなら段階的に投資して効果を確かめられそうです。要するに、まず試験導入で精度と処理速度を確認し、将来的に現場へ落とし込む戦略が現実的だと理解してよろしいですね。

その通りですよ。大丈夫、一緒に段階を踏めば必ずできますよ。まずは小さなデータセットでAM法を検証して、効果が出るならSVD法により高速化を図る。これが現実的で投資対効果の高い進め方です。

分かりました。自分の言葉で言うと、『この論文は、データの掛け合わせ構造を使って少ない情報からでも正確に信号を復元する手法を示し、安定性のあるAM法と高速なSVD法という二本柱で実用化に近づけている。まずは小規模で試し、効果が確認できれば段階的に導入する』ということですね。
1. 概要と位置づけ
結論ファーストで述べると、この研究の最も大きな貢献は、Kronecker構造を持つ辞書を前提にしたスパース復元問題に対して、理論保証付きの安定な推定法と高速な近似法という両立を可能にした点である。通信やセンサーの分野で見られる多次元データにはこうした掛け合わせ構造が自然に現れ、従来法より少ない観測で高精度を実現できる可能性が高いのである。背景として、スパース性を仮定した信号復元は情報圧縮やノイズ下での推定に強みを持つが、辞書の持つ構造を十分に活かせないと効率が落ちるという課題があった。本研究はその構造性を階層的なベイズ事前分布でモデル化し、実用的なアルゴリズム設計へと結び付けている。実務上は、データの構造が合致する領域で投資対効果が見込める研究である。
2. 先行研究との差別化ポイント
結論から言えば、本論文は既存のKronecker構造利用手法と比べて理論的な収束保証と実務的な計算速化の両立を示した点で差別化されている。従来の手法は多くが近似や経験的な調整に依存し、最適性や収束に関する証明が不足していた。本研究はSparse Bayesian Learning (SBL)(スパースベイズ学習)フレームワークを採用し、Expectation-Maximization (EM)(期待値最大化法)を基にして問題を定式化したうえで、交互最小化(Alternating Minimization、AM)により定式化した最適化問題の停留点への到達を理論的に示した。さらに、Singular Value Decomposition (SVD)(特異値分解)を用いる近似で高速かつ競合的な精度を達成しており、これが先行研究に対する実質的な優位点である。要するに理論と実装の両面でギャップを埋めた研究である。
3. 中核となる技術的要素
結論を先に述べると、技術的中核は「Kronecker構造を持つハイパーパラメータによる階層ベイズモデル化」と「AMとSVDを組み合わせた実装」である。本研究では、観測行列や辞書がテンソル的掛け合わせ構造を持つと仮定し、そのサポート(非ゼロ成分の配置)もKronecker構造で表現した。これに対してSparse Bayesian Learning (SBL)を用い、ハイパーパラメータにKronecker構造を持たせることで次元爆発を抑えながら構造を反映できるようにした。解法として、交互最小化(AM)により各因子を順次最適化する方法を提示し、それに対する収束解析を行った。一方で実務上の計算負荷を下げるため、特異値分解(SVD)を使った高速近似を導入し、精度と速度のトレードオフを実験的に評価した。
4. 有効性の検証方法と成果
まず結論的に言うと、検証は合成データと応用例であるIRS支援MIMO(Intelligent Reflecting Surface (IRS)(知的反射面)支援Multiple-Input Multiple-Output (MIMO)(多入力多出力))のチャネル推定に対して行われ、AM法は収束性と安定性を示し、SVD法は高速かつ場合によっては高精度であった。実験ではKronecker構造を仮定したモデルが正しい場合に明確な利得が観測され、ブロックスパース性(block sparsity)を扱う拡張も効果を示した。理論解析では、AM法がSBLのコスト関数の停留点に到達することが示され、ローカルミニマに関する議論も付されている。要するに、理論的保証と実験的有効性の双方で改善を確認した。
5. 研究を巡る議論と課題
結論を先に述べると、有望ではあるが実運用に向けては構造の適合性確認、計算資源配分、ロバスト性の検証が課題である。まず、Kronecker仮定が現実データにどの程度合致するかはケースバイケースであり、仮定違反時の性能劣化が懸念される。次に、AM法は収束保証があるが反復コストが発生し、SVD近似は速いが近似誤差の評価が必要である。さらに、ノイズやモデル誤差に対するロバスト性、オンライン処理やリアルタイム性への対応は今後の重要課題である。したがって取り組みは段階的に、まずは検証用パイロットで仮定の妥当性と計算負荷を評価することが賢明である。
6. 今後の調査・学習の方向性
結論として、実機適用を目指すなら、(1) 仮定の妥当性検証、(2) AM→SVDの段階的移行、(3) ブロック化や近似法のさらなる最適化、の三点を進めるべきである。本研究自身も、SVDを基にしたさらなる高速化やリアルタイム性の向上を今後の課題として挙げている。実務的には、小規模データでの検証を繰り返し、ハードウェアとクラウドの適切な役割分担を設計することで、投資対効果を確かめながら導入を進めるのが現実的である。検索や追加調査の際に役立つ英語キーワードは次の通りである: “Kronecker-structured sparse recovery”, “Sparse Bayesian Learning (SBL)”, “Kronecker-structured prior”, “Alternating Minimization (AM)”, “SVD-based sparse recovery”, “IRS-aided MIMO channel estimation”。
会議で使えるフレーズ集
『まずは仮説の構造が我々のデータに合うかを小さく検証しましょう。これが合致すれば少ないセンサで十分な精度が期待できます。』
『最初は安定性のあるAM法をサーバ側で評価し、成果が見え次第SVDベースの高速化を進めたい。』
『投資は段階的に行い、初期フェーズで効果が出れば現場への展開を本格化する方針で行きましょう。』


